About The Position

MTSI is seeking a Program Security Representative to provide security support for classified DoW technology programs. In this role, you will ensure compliance with national security directives, safeguard sensitive program information, and orchestrate security architectures to meet complex technological requirements. This position demands a collaborative professional with deep knowledge of DoW security policies, SCIF/SAPF accreditation processes, and national security systems. As a Program Security Representative, you’ll be a part of safeguarding Department of War initiatives that are vital to national security and technological advancement. You’ll be able to leverage your expertise while collaborating with multi-disciplinary teams on a high-visibility program.

Requirements

  • Minimum of eight years working in DoW program security for classified programs
  • Implementing security architectures for new initiatives
  • Interpreting and applying NISPOM, DCID, ICD, and SAP policies
  • Working with NISS, DISS, and other national security systems
  • Ensuring security policies are implemented effectively
  • Supporting SAPF and SCIF accreditation processes
  • Bachelor's degree
  • Must possess an active DoW Top Secret (TS) security clearance (with SCI and SAP/CAP eligibility)

Responsibilities

  • Implement and manage security for classified programs and ensure protection of sensitive information
  • Apply in-depth knowledge of NISPOM, DCID, ICD, and SAP policy to maintain compliance across all program security activities
  • Utilize systems (e.g., NISS, DISS) to streamline security workflows and communications
  • Lead efforts in securing and accrediting Sensitive Compartmented Information Facilities and Special Access Program Facilities to meet established standards
  • Foster strong relationships with internal teams, stakeholders, and visitors while communicating security requirements clearly and effectively
